    A touching and set of true stories about every-day Balkan people who saved Jews during the Holocaust.

    Until business took me to the Balkans (2003-2010) I had no idea of the fact that all the Jews of Albania were protected during WW2 and that many were protected in other parts of the Balkans, as well. This book of true vignettes illustrates once again that good people of any religion will always know right from wrong and will do the right thing in the face of oppression, to protect their neighbors. I only wish that a bit more information was given about each case and that references for readers unfamiliar with the Balkans were a bit more clear.
